14:22 — So this is where it got weird. The Cartwheel driver-assignment heuristic started pairing drivers in Millbrook with pickups across the river in Dunhollow, because the new distance weighting treated the ferry route as a zero-cost edge. Dispatch noticed wait times spiking and paged us. We rolled the weighting change back within twenty minutes and assignments normalized. Full fix lands next sprint once the Pathworks team patches the graph import. The offending build is identified below.

build token for tawip-yageg: htk9_92ac43d42

Handover: EXIF Scrubber (Pixelmoth)

Dario — you're on call for Pixelmoth this week. The EXIF scrubbing worker now strips GPS and serial tags before anything hits the public CDN; the old lazy-scrub path is fully retired. Watch the scrub-queue depth dashboard — over 5k pending usually means the sidecar crashed again. Restarting it is safe and idempotent. If the sealed config bundle won't decrypt on restart, you'll need to re-key it with the standby credentials. The re-key script will ask for the recovery passphrase, which is the following.

unlock words, hahip-baduf: holwyn-istath-julvan

This alert means Tessellate found two irreconcilable versions of the same event while syncing between a user's primary calendar and a linked workspace calendar. It typically occurs when both copies were edited during an offline window, leaving conflicting start times or attendee lists. Tessellate pauses sync for that user rather than guessing, so support must resolve the conflict manually. Do not force a re-sync first; that can silently drop one version. The step-by-step resolution guide for support staff is on our internal page.

operations page: https://jenkins.zemvarcloud.local/job/merge_requests/repo/build/73930b4b30f0a8ed

**Handover Note — Fire-Drill Roll Call (Thursday)**

Hi Marguerite,

Thursday's drill at Ashenfield Court starts at 10:15 sharp. Please take the roll-call clipboard and both visitor logs to Muster Point B, by the cedar planters. Tick off every name, including contractors from Rookmere Joinery, and radio any absences to the warden immediately. Afterwards, staff will re-enter through the side lobby only, as the main turnstiles stay locked for twenty minutes. To release the side lobby door, enter the code below.

staff pass of kawip-hawef = bdg-QLP-2